B. Riley FBR analyst Lucas Pipes lowered his price target for Cleveland-Cliffs to $13 from $16 to reflect the "evolving" macro environment and price environment. Last month, Platts reported a 35% decline in Atlantic pellet premiums to $40/dmt, the analyst points out. The analyst estimates this reduction lowered Cleveland-Cliffs' sales margins by approximately $10/lt on an annual basis. Until we see a material improvement in steel mill economics, Atlantic pellet premiums pricing could stay at these current levels for the next several quarters, Pipes tells investors in a research note. Nonetheless, the analyst continues to believe that Cleveland-Cliff is an attractive stock with "substantial upside even in the current price environment." He keeps a Buy rating on the shares.
